    Website. shu .ac .uk. Sheffield Hallam University ( SHU) is a public research university in Sheffield, South Yorkshire, England. The university is based on two sites; the City Campus is located in the city centre near Sheffield railway station, while the Collegiate Crescent Campus is about two miles away in the Broomhall Estate off Ecclesall ...

    The annual Sheffield Varsity is an annual varsity match that takes place between sports teams from the university and its rival Sheffield Hallam University starting from 1996. The varsity is divided into winter and summer competitions. Over 1,000 students from both universities compete in over 30 varsity sports in more than 70 events.

    Sheffield Hallam's £15m "beacon for health and social care education" was officially opened at Collegiate Crescent by the University Chancellor, Professor the Lord Winston, in May 2005. It was the site of the former City of Sheffield Training College, a teacher training institute and one of the predecessor institutions of the university.
